Work Academy and Free Courses
Added: 01 October 2018
We offer free courses for people aged 19 years and over (before 31 August 2018) and in receipt of JSA, ESA or Universal Credit. Our courses lead to people achieving accredited qualification. We offer a fantastic learning environment for people to learn more, meet new people and take the right steps to finding work.
WORK ACADEMY- For anyone looking for Customer Advisor work, we continue to deliver a brilliant 3 week work academy for Sigma Financial Group. The next assessment date will be Tuesday 9th October at 10am from Matthew Boulton College. More details here. The job offers a £16,300 starting salary (17k after 3 month probation) and the opportunity for a full time, long term career in sales and finance. This is ideal for people who have a good telephone manner, good IT skills and the flexibility to work a variety of shifts (Mon-Sat 8am-10pm).
You can make a referral by calling us on 0121 362 1174 or apply online at www.bmet.ac.uk/jobseekers.
